首页 > 数据库 >用SQL语句统计一个表有多少列

用SQL语句统计一个表有多少列

时间:2023-09-19 14:02:16浏览次数:41  
标签:语句 name 表名 表有 SQL syscolumns id select sysobjects


1.oracle数据库
   select count( column_name )
   from user_tab_columns
   where table_name = '表名'; --表名为大写

2.sqlserver数据库
   select   count(syscolumns.name)
   from   syscolumns   ,   sysobjects    
   where   syscolumns.id   =   sysobjects.id  
   and   sysobjects.name   =   '表名'

标签:语句,name,表名,表有,SQL,syscolumns,id,select,sysobjects
From: https://blog.51cto.com/u_1481758/7524838

相关文章

  • 慢SQL治理实践及落地成果分享 | 京东物流技术团队
    一、治理背景数据库系统性能问题会对应用程序的性能和用户体验产生负面影响。慢查询可能导致应用程序响应变慢、请求堆积、系统负载增加等问题,甚至引发系统崩溃或不可用的情况。慢SQL治理是在数据库系统中针对执行缓慢的SQL查询进行优化和改进的一项重要工作。但原有的治理节奏,一般......
  • 腾讯Fast-Causal-Inference已经在GitHub中公布,采用SQL交互
          腾讯近日宣布旗下的开源分布式数据科学组件项目Fast-Causal-Inference已经在GitHub中公布。根据公开资料显示,这是由腾讯微信研发,采用SQL交互的,基于分布式向量化的统计分析、因果推断计算库,宣称“解决已有统计模型库(R/Python)在大数据下的性能瓶颈,提供百亿......
  • 慢SQL的致胜法宝 | 京东物流技术团队
    大促备战,最大的隐患项之一就是慢SQL,对于服务平稳运行带来的破坏性最大,也是日常工作中经常带来整个应用抖动的最大隐患,在日常开发中如何避免出现慢SQL,出现了慢SQL应该按照什么思路去解决是我们必须要知道的。本文主要介绍对于慢SQL的排查、解决思路,通过一个个实际的例子深入分析总结......
  • 慢SQL治理实践及落地成果分享
    一、治理背景数据库系统性能问题会对应用程序的性能和用户体验产生负面影响。慢查询可能导致应用程序响应变慢、请求堆积、系统负载增加等问题,甚至引发系统崩溃或不可用的情况。慢SQL治理是在数据库系统中针对执行缓慢的SQL查询进行优化和改进的一项重要工作。但原有的治理节奏,......
  • python连接mysql
    pymysql是Python的一个MySQL数据库操作库,支持连接MySQL服务器,并进行数据库操作。例如以下代码段演示了如何使用pymysql库将数据存储到MySQL数据库py代码importpymysqldb=pymysql.connect(host='localhost',user='test',password='test',database='test',charset='utf8'......
  • python处理xls数据并保存到mysql数据库
    #-*-coding:utf-8-*-#CreatedbyY.W.on2017/7/3117:46.importpymysqlimportxlrd#获取xlsx文件,获取sheet文件try:book=xlrd.open_workbook('D:/test.xls')sheet=book.sheet_by_name(u'Sheet1')exceptExceptionase:prin......
  • MySQL优化(业务系统)
    影响一个系统的运行速度的原因是多方面的,前端、后端、数据库、中间件、服务器、网络等等,今天我们从常常被关注的数据库角度出发。跟系统的优化方向一样,数据库的优化,也是多方面的,其中涵盖着SQL语句的执行情况,数据库自身的情况等等,数据库种类众多,下面我们以目前常用的Mysql数据库为......
  • 将图片插入到SQL Server数据库
    --新建表imagecreatetableimage(img_idint,imgimage) 拖控件TADOQuery包含Jpeg.hpp//存入图片://image以二进制形式存放图片ADOQuery1->Close();ADOQuery1->SQL->Clear();ADOQuery1->SQL->Add("insertintoimagevalues(:img_id,:img)");ADOQuery1->Paramet......
  • 更改SQL Server sa密码、默认端口 以及ADO连接字符串指定端口号
    1、更改sa密码execsp_passwordnull,'000','sa'--将sa密码改为0002、更改SQLSERVER默认端口     (1)SqlServer服务使用两个端口:TCP-1433、UDP-1434。其中1433用于供SqlServer对外提供服务,1434用于向请求者返回SqlServer使用了那个TCP/IP端口。可以使用SQLServer的企业管......
  • 常见的Java中SQL注解的用法
    @Select:用于查询操作,标注在方法上,指定相应的SQL查询语句。@Select("SELECT*FROMtable_nameWHEREcondition")List<Entity>getEntities();@Insert:用于插入操作,标注在方法上,指定相应的SQL插入语句@Insert("INSERTINTOtable_name(column1,column2)VALUES(#{value1}......